What is the equation for the efficiency of a device that transfers energy?

Respuesta :

irille14
irille14 irille14
  • 21-10-2019

Answer:

efficiency = useful energy out ÷ total energy in (for a decimal efficiency)

or.

efficiency = (useful energy out ÷ total energy in) × 100 (for a percentage efficiency)
